区别 第7页

CSS ::first-line伪元素:首行文本特殊样式

CSS ::first-line伪元素:首行文本特殊样式-创客网
::first-line伪元素用于对块级元素的第一行文本应用样式。1.它只能应用于块级元素如p、h1-h6、div,不支持行内元素如span;2.支持字体、颜色、背景和文本装饰属性,不支持margin、padding等布局...
消失的彩虹的头像-创客网消失的彩虹27天前
03310

CSS选择器创建自定义复选框和单选按钮

CSS选择器创建自定义复选框和单选按钮-创客网
1.隐藏原生控件,使用opacity:0和定位覆盖自定义样式;2.通过label与span构建结构,用:checked状态切换样式;3.单选按钮需保持name一致并使用圆形样式;4.确保无障碍支持。通过将原生input设为...
消失的彩虹的头像-创客网消失的彩虹27天前
04415

CSS中word-break和word-wrap处理长文本的差异

CSS中word-break和word-wrap处理长文本的差异-创客网
在CSS中,word-break和overflow-wrap(原word-wrap)用于控制文本换行,但使用场景不同。word-break偏向强制断词,不考虑语义合理性;overflow-wrap则优先保持单词完整,只在必要时断开。1.word...
消失的彩虹的头像-创客网消失的彩虹27天前
0356

CSS中grid-template-columns和grid-auto-columns的区别

CSS中grid-template-columns和grid-auto-columns的区别-创客网
grid-template-columns用于手动定义列宽,适用于固定结构布局;grid-auto-columns用于自动创建列,适用于动态内容扩展。例如:grid-template-columns:200px1fr2fr;定义三列宽度;而grid-auto-co...
消失的彩虹的头像-创客网消失的彩虹27天前
04213

CSS中line-height单位px和百分比的渲染差异

CSS中line-height单位px和百分比的渲染差异-创客网
line-height用px和百分比的区别在于计算方式与适应场景。1.px是固定值,如line-height:24px,行高始终为24px,适合按钮等需精确控制的组件;优点直观可控,缺点不够灵活。2.百分比是相对值,如l...
消失的彩虹的头像-创客网消失的彩虹28天前
02511

CSS :nth-child()进阶:奇偶行、间隔选择技巧

CSS :nth-child()进阶:奇偶行、间隔选择技巧-创客网
:nth-child()选择器之所以成为前端利器,是因为它能基于元素在兄弟节点中的位置应用样式,极大提升代码效率与可维护性。1.核心用法是An+B表达式:odd/2n+1选奇数项,even/2n选偶数项;3n+1等实...
消失的彩虹的头像-创客网消失的彩虹28天前
0396

CSS :focus-within伪类:子元素聚焦时父容器样式变化

CSS :focus-within伪类:子元素聚焦时父容器样式变化-创客网
:focus-within是一个CSS伪类,当元素自身或其任意后代获得焦点时触发样式变化。1.它与:focus的区别在于::focus仅在自身获得焦点时生效,而:focus-within在其子元素获得焦点时也会生效;2.可用...
消失的彩虹的头像-创客网消失的彩虹28天前
03812

BOM中如何检测用户的键盘输入?

BOM中如何检测用户的键盘输入?-创客网
检测键盘输入需监听keydown、keypress或keyup事件,选择依据为需求和兼容性。步骤如下:1.选择监听目标,如document或特定DOM元素;2.使用addEventListener监听相应事件;3.编写处理函数获取eve...
消失的彩虹的头像-创客网消失的彩虹28天前
0247

td和th标签有什么区别?分别在什么情况下使用?

td和th标签有什么区别?分别在什么情况下使用?-创客网
用于表头,具有语义和可访问性功能,而仅表示数据单元格。常用于定义列或行标题,并支持scope属性明确关联数据范围,浏览器默认加粗显示,且能被屏幕阅读器识别以提升可访问性;相比之下,只用...
消失的彩虹的头像-创客网消失的彩虹29天前
02410

如何用BOM获取当前页面的URL?

如何用BOM获取当前页面的URL?-创客网
获取当前页面的完整URL最直接的方法是使用window.location.href属性。1.window.location.href返回包含协议、主机名、路径、查询参数和哈希值的完整URL字符串;2.window.location对象还提供多个...
消失的彩虹的头像-创客网消失的彩虹29天前
03214

如何为HTML表格添加交替列颜色?CSS如何实现?

如何为HTML表格添加交替列颜色?CSS如何实现?-创客网
最直接且优雅为HTML表格添加交替列颜色的方式是使用CSS的nth-child伪类选择器作用于元素。1.通过td:nth-child(even)和td:nth-child(odd)分别设置偶数列和奇数列的背景色;2.nth-child基于同级元...
消失的彩虹的头像-创客网消失的彩虹29天前
03112

confirm方法的作用是什么?怎么用它获取用户确认?

confirm方法的作用是什么?怎么用它获取用户确认?-创客网
confirm方法是浏览器提供的用于获取用户“是/否”确认的机制,其核心作用是返回布尔值:点击“确定”返回true,点击“取消”或关闭对话框返回false。它常用于删除操作、提交表单前确认、离开未...
消失的彩虹的头像-创客网消失的彩虹30天前
0316

history对象的功能是什么?如何用它控制页面导航?

history对象的功能是什么?如何用它控制页面导航?-创客网
单页应用(SPA)离不开historyAPI,因为它解决了无刷新页面切换时的URL同步和浏览器导航问题。通过history.pushState和replaceState方法,开发者可以动态修改URL并维护历史记录,使用户能使用“...
消失的彩虹的头像-创客网消失的彩虹30天前
0215

如何用BOM获取用户的设备方向?

如何用BOM获取用户的设备方向?-创客网
要通过BOM获取用户设备方向,需监听deviceorientation事件,该事件提供alpha、beta和gamma三个角度值,分别表示设备在Z轴、X轴和Y轴上的旋转和倾斜。具体步骤如下:①检查浏览器是否支持DeviceO...
消失的彩虹的头像-创客网消失的彩虹30天前
03613

html中figure标签什么意思_figure标签的搭配使用说明

html中figure标签什么意思_figure标签的搭配使用说明-创客网
figure标签通过结合figcaption和img的alt属性提升可访问性,具体步骤如下:1.为图像添加清晰描述性的alt属性;2.使用figcaption提供简洁标题或说明,帮助屏幕阅读器用户理解内容。正确使用语义...
消失的彩虹的头像-创客网消失的彩虹30天前
0486

PHP isset() 的陷阱:为何空值和 $_GET 参数仍返回 true?

PHP isset() 的陷阱:为何空值和 $_GET 参数仍返回 true?-创客网
本教程深入探讨PHP中isset()函数的行为,尤其是在处理空字符串和通过$_GET接收的表单参数时。文章将解释为何即使表单字段为空或在JavaScript中为undefined,isset()仍可能返回true,并详细对比i...
消失的彩虹的头像-创客网消失的彩虹30天前
0386